Quick update for the board: our lease at the Harrowfen Commons site expires in March, and honestly the timing works in our favor. Vacancy in the district is up, so Penmark Realty is suddenly very flexible. We're asking for a 15% reduction, two years of capped escalation, and an early-exit clause. Counsel says the draft terms look clean. Worst case, we relocate to the Stellwick Annex at comparable cost.

One more thing the board should see before deciding — the confidential strategy note is appended directly below.

management briefing: Gormirox Partners plans to lower the Pelmir list price by 17 percent in March.

### Key Ceremony Checklist — Item 7: Billing Worker Blue-Green Cutover

Hey, welcome to the Tallowbrook crew! Before flipping traffic from blue to green on the Ledgerline billing worker, confirm both stacks have signed manifests from this ceremony. Don't skip the dry-run invoice batch — it catches 90% of config drift.

If the green stack's signing key needs to be unsealed mid-ceremony and the quorum holders are out, the fallback unseal passphrase is recorded below.

unlock words, yawig-kagef: gordor-holvan-ulaael-pramir-ulaiel-tamdor

Quarterly Planning Note — Loyalty Programme Overhaul. Sales leads: the Bramleaf Rewards scheme will be restructured next quarter. The points-per-purchase model is being replaced with tiered membership, as redemption costs have outpaced incremental revenue for three straight quarters. Existing balances will convert at a fixed rate; messaging packs arrive in week two. Expect some customer pushback at the counter — scripts will be provided. The underlying rationale is summarised below.

confidential, yahip-hagug: Gorixax Logistics plans to lower the Ulaael list price by 26.6 percent in October. The pricing group signed off on a budget of $199.9 million for Project Holix. The renewal with Kasdorox Systems closes at $137.5 million a year, 8.2 percent above the last contract. Project Lamion slips by a full year because of the audit delay.